We have studied sofar
the significance of the 5 years in the cycle of 60 and added some
comments .
The five years studied are
: Prabhava , Vibhava , Sukla , PramOdhUta and PrajOtpatti
.
Prabhava stands for the
amita ( limitless PrabhAvams of the Supreme Brahman sung by VedAs and Upanishads
.
Vibhava stands for the
vibhava avatArams of Raaama and KrishNa , when the Lord mingled with us at
AyOddhi and Gokulam/BrindhAvanam .
Sukla stands for Sukla
Yajur Vedam .
PramOdhUta stands for the
dhUtya Kaimkaryam of the Lord , who blessed us with Bhagavad GeethA . It also stands for
Sundara KaaNDam , which deals with the Raama DhUtan , AnjanEyar.
PrajOtpatti stands for
Chathurmukha Brahmaa , the direct son of the Lord .

(Commentary) : Aangiras is a Vedic
sage, the creator of the fourth Veda ( Atharvam) with sage Atharvan . He is one
of the Gotra Rishis and is also one of the 7 Rishis of the First
Manvantara.
He is a Maanasa putra of Brahma and his
son is the Deva Guru , Bruhaspati .
Sage Angherasa figures prominently in
MuNdaka Upanishad. He is also an author of Aaangheerasa Smrithi , spelling
out the code of conduct for us .He is also considered as the Second Agni:
PraJApatya Agni . The name of the sixth year linking to PrAjaapatya Agni follows
that of the name of the fifth year , PrajOtpatthi .

(Comments): Srimad Azhagiya Singar has
intrepreted the name of this
year as "BahudhA anya: ". It
is indeed different from other years .The year was BahudhAnya ( 1398 C.E) , when Lord Naraimhan initiated a
twenty year old scholar
from ThirunArAyaNa Puram into
SanyAsAsramam and commanded him to be
the Founding Jeeyar of SrI
Ahobila Matam .In the same year , this Jeeyar visited AzhwAr Thirunagari and
recovered the archa
vigraham of Swamy NammAzhwAr from a deep well and brought Him back to
AdhinAthan's temple . It was this year , which saw Swamy
NammAzhwAr blessing the Jeeyar with Hamsa Mudhrai and the EmperumAn , Adhi
Naathan conferring the title of "Adhi VaNN" on this
Jeeyar.
During another BahudhAnya Year (1099 C.E
Thai month,Punarvasu Nakshatram) AchArya RaamAnuja had arrived at ThirunArAyaNapuram for a
12 year long historic stay .It was during another BahudhA+ anya year , Brahma Tantra Jeeyar I presented the
Taniyan of " Sri RaamAnuja Dayaa Paatram " to His AchAryan , Swamy Desikan
at Thiru NaarAyaNa Puram. This year was 1338 C.E.
In other BahudhAnya Years , the 2nd ,
17th and 23rd Jeeyars ascended the Ahobila Mata Peetam ; the years were 1458 ,
1698 and 1758 C.E respectively.
The 42nd Jeeyar of Ahobila Matam and
MahA VidwAn and
GhOshtipuram Swamy were born in another BahudhAnya year
( 1878 C.E).
